Logo
INTEGRITY Security Services Inc

ISS Senior Software Engineer (SSWENG)

INTEGRITY Security Services Inc, Irvine, California, United States, 92713


ISS Senior Software Engineer (SSWENG)

INTEGRITY Security Services (ISS) is a part of the Green Hills Software (GHS) family with a specific mission to deliver world-class end-to-end security solutions. ISS Software Engineers develop comprehensive web and server solutions using secure technologies enabling enterprises, developers, and end-users to release and maintain embedded products with uncompromising security.Job Description

An ISS Senior Software Engineer designs, develops, tests, and debugs moderate to complex computer software with moderate guidance. The engineer is capable of providing design recommendations required to achieve cost and schedule targets, and works as part of a small and highly productive team to meet the needs of our growing and evolving fast-paced business. In addition to producing quality code, the engineer must be passionate, versatile, flexible, and eager to tackle difficult technology challenges as we grow.Essential Functions

Work with a small team of developers to solve engineering problems for cyber security platformsMeet with customers, peer developers, and internal business units to capture requirementsWrite specifications and high-level design solutions for approvalRapid-prototype mock-up designs to meet target requirementsDesign secure network and web systems through creative, clever, and innovative thinkingHandle all aspects of the software and system lifecycle from conception to deliveryBuild, design, and deploy high quality solutions while utilizing multiple technologies and toolsResearch and recommend engineering solutions for new productsCollaborate with team members to problem solve system-level solutionsConduct peer code reviews to ensure quality software developmentProactively identifies and resolves inefficient systemsPerforms other related duties as assignedCompetencies

Strong Experience with core web technologies including HTML, JavaScript, and REST APIsStrong understanding of network and web security technologies including Firewalls, VPNs, encryption, and security protocols such as PKI and TLSExperience with deploying and managing high-availability cloud services such as AWS or AzureExperience with server-side frameworks such as Node.jsDemonstrate working knowledge of SQL/NoSQL databasesPossess working knowledge of major operating systems including Linux, Windows, and OS-XEffective communication skills, both written and oralAbility to work efficiently and use time effectivelyCapable of working independently or as part of a small teamKnowledge of C & C++ desirablePosition Type/Expected Hours of Work

This is a full-time position. Days and hours of work are Monday through Friday 8:30 a.m. to 5 p.m.Travel

No overnight travel is anticipated for this position. Some occasional local day travel may be necessary.Required Education and Experience

Bachelor's degree in software, computer, electronics, or other relevant engineering disciplines4 years or more experience developing in core web technologies including HTML, JavaScript, Node.js, REST API, AWS cloud services, and server/client-side architecturePreferred: Master's degree in engineeringWork Authorization/Security Clearance

Must be a U.S. citizenOther Duties

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ities and activities may change at any time with or without notice.The US base salary range for this full-time position is $80,000 - $146,000 + bonus + equity + benefits DOEContact

INTEGRITY Security ServicesHiring Manager300 Spectrum Center DriveSuite 800Irvine, CA 92618(949) 756-0690 (phone)(949) 756-0691 (fax)INTEGRITY Security ServicesHiring Manager883 Boylston St.3rd FloorBoston, MA 02116iss.careers@ghsiss.comhttps://ghsiss.com